Knob Sweep Function
Step Time
Step time is the time width of a sweep step as shown in the following figure. For
knob sweep measurements, you cannot set the delay time. Instead, you set the step
time, which you can only set on the KNOB SWEEP screen.
Setup range is 0.5 ms to 100 ms, with 100 ms resolution.
For normal sweep measurement, the step time depends on the measurement time.
For knob sweep measurement, step time is always this specified value.
Measurement Channel
You select the measurement channel by selecting the Y-AXIS ASSIGN softkey on
the KNOB SWEEP screen, then selecting the desired secondary softkey. You can
select one measurement channel only, so the Y2 axis is not available on the KNOB
SWEEP screen.
• default measurement channel
• When an SMU is set to VAR1
Measurement channel is the VAR1 channel.
• When a VSU is set to VAR1
Measurement channel is the first found channel that can measure. Searching
order is:
SMU1 ® .....® SMU6 ® VMU1 ® VMU2.
• restrictions
If you use series resistance for VAR1 channel and VAR1 channel is V force
mode, only VAR1 measurement channel can be assigned to Y axis.
NOTE Measurement Resolution
When performing knob sweep measurement, measurement resolution of each
measurement unit is worse than the measurement resolution of normal sweep
measurements. For details of measurement resolution, refer to Chapter 1.
